India Sets Its Sights on the 2036 Olympics: Charting the Route to Host the Games

May 15, 20262 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ter Email
Share
Facebook Twitter Email


India Reviews Commonwealth Games Preparations and Olympic Bid

In a recent online meeting, India’s plans for the Commonwealth Games were discussed alongside the country’s bid for the 2036 Olympics. The session was led by Union Sports Minister Mansukh Mandaviya and included Gujarat’s Deputy Chief Minister, Harsh Sanghavi, who joined from afar.

Held on Thursday, the meeting welcomed key officials from the Indian Olympic Association (IOA). Sanghavi, who also oversees sports, youth affairs, and cultural activities in Gujarat, was supported by other representatives from the state.

The main focus of the discussion was the upcoming closing ceremony of the 2026 Commonwealth Games. During this event, responsibility will be transferred to Ahmedabad, designated as the host for the 2030 edition. However, the topic of India’s Olympic bid also emerged in conversation, as stakeholders assessed the next steps once the selection process resumes.

While no significant decisions were made, participants shared insights on the future trajectory of the bidding process. Last year, the International Olympic Committee (IOC) paused host selections to reassess its criteria; however, progress is expected to restart by the end of this year or early next year.

India is currently in the “Continuous Dialogue” phase regarding its Olympic bid after expressing interest in hosting the Games in Ahmedabad by October 2024.

Additionally, Minister Mandaviya took the opportunity to evaluate preparations for the Commonwealth Games scheduled for Glasgow in July and August. A statement from the Sports Ministry highlighted the need for coordination among all parties involved, with a focus on ensuring robust support for Indian athletes training for the 2026 Commonwealth Games.

An “India House” is anticipated to be established during the Games to provide additional support for athletes. The meeting also reviewed inter-ministerial coordination, with efforts aimed at operational and logistical preparations for Glasgow 2026. This includes collaboration with the Ministry of External Affairs, along with departments related to culture and tourism, to facilitate smooth operations for the athletes.

In summary, the meeting served as a crucial step in setting the stage for future athletic events in India, ensuring that preparations continue seamlessly.
